Optro (formerly AuditBoard), an AI-powered governance, risk, and compliance (GRC) platform, has announced its expansion into Singapore as its newest regional hub. The move marks a strategic step in strengthening its presence across the Asia Pacific (APAC) region and enhancing localized support for global enterprise risk and compliance teams.
The expansion comes as organizations face rising complexity in regulatory requirements, cybersecurity threats, and AI-driven digital transformation.
Optro has established Singapore as its newest regional center, reinforcing its commitment to supporting enterprise governance, risk, and compliance needs across Asia Pacific. The expansion was announced at The Institute of Internal Auditors (IIA) International Conference 2026 in Singapore.
The move positions Optro closer to high-growth markets where organizations are rapidly modernizing risk management practices in response to evolving regulatory and technological landscapes.
The expansion comes at a time when enterprises across APAC are navigating increasingly complex risk environments. Key challenges include AI adoption, cybersecurity threats, regulatory changes, and accelerated digital transformation.
Industry data indicates that digital disruption, including AI, is now among the top business risks for a significant portion of organizations, while regulatory change remains a major audit priority. These trends are driving demand for more integrated and AI-driven GRC solutions.
Optro’s platform is designed to support audit, risk, compliance, and information security teams through AI-powered automation and centralized risk management capabilities. The company’s expansion into Singapore enhances access to localized support, enabling enterprises to better manage governance requirements across diverse regulatory frameworks.
The platform also integrates with global consulting and advisory ecosystems to support enterprise-scale risk transformation initiatives.
A key focus of Optro’s strategy is the advancement of agentic GRC, where AI-driven systems automate governance and compliance workflows. Following its acquisition of Midship, Optro has strengthened its capabilities in autonomous controls testing and risk automation.
The combined platform can automate a significant portion of controls management processes, allowing audit and compliance teams to shift focus toward strategic risk analysis and decision-making.
